Jeffrey Hall puts firefighting skills to good use for Rotorua car wash fundraiser

Rotorua Daily Post
21 Mar, 2018 03:00 PM3 mins to read

Jeffery Hall is used to being behind a hose in his role as a firefighter – only this time he'll be using it to wash cars.

The Rotorua Airport firefighter is holding a car wash on Friday as part of his fundraising efforts ahead of his third Sky Tower Stair Challenge. The popular Sky Tower event is a fundraiser for Leukaemia and Blood Cancer New Zealand.

Between 10am and 2pm he'll be washing cars on site at Rotorua Airport, with all the donations going to the cause close to his heart.

The car wash will be his largest fundraiser ahead of the challenge in May. So far Hall has raised almost $3600, just short of the $3800 he raised last year.

Hall said the fundraising aspect was one of the parts he enjoyed most about the challenge.

"It is very humbling, seeing all the people who have a link to the cause. One lady gave me $100, which was just amazing."

Hall knows only too well the personal element, losing his sister to cancer. This time around he'll carry a photograph in memory of 14-year-old Connor Hewitson, a family friend who died from leukaemia.

"It's an honour to take him up to the top with me. You know you're doing it for someone."

Hall has been training by running up the stairs at the Rotorua Novotel, as well as tracks in Rotorua's Redwoods. Despite it being his third time taking part, he has been training more than ever.

His 2018 goal is to shave one minute off last year's time, completing the 51 flights of stairs (1103 stairs all up) in 15 minutes or less.

"It's such a good event and a good cause."

Hall said he was also grateful to the support of Thrifty Car Rentals at Rotorua Airport which had helped with fundraising and would be lending a hand on Friday at the car wash.

Rotorua Airport chief executive Mark Gibb said the airport was proud of Hall's commitment to the challenge.

Gibb said they're happy to support the fundraising efforts by allowing the car wash at the airport site.

"It's fantastic to see the airport community and wider community support this cause, and we hope plenty of people take advantage of Friday's car wash to help with Mr Hall's fundraising efforts."
